Q: Is 161,398 a Prime Number?
A: No, 161,398 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 161398 can be evenly divided by 1 2 17 34 47 94 101 202 799 1,598 1,717 3,434 4,747 9,494 80,699 and 161,398, with no remainder.
Since 161,398 cannot be divided by just 1 and 161,398, it is not a prime number.
